Weight management

Recognizing the diverse needs of various demographics, customizing weight management strategies is crucial for achieving effective and sustainable outcomes. This comprehensive approach ensures that each group’s unique needs, challenges, and goals are addressed. Consulting with professionals, including registered dietitians, fitness trainers, and healthcare providers, guarantees that the selected strategies are efficient and maintainable for long-term success.

Weight Loss

Adults with Sedentary Lifestyles:
  • Caloric Control and Nutrient Density: Gradual calorie reduction should be coupled with nutrient-dense choices. Prioritize lean proteins, fiber-rich whole grains, colorful fruits, and vegetables.
  • Incorporating Movement: Encourage regular physical activity through simple changes like taking stairs, standing breaks, or short walks. Combine these with structured exercise routines.
  • Mindful Eating: Stress the importance of mindful eating to foster awareness of hunger and fullness cues. This helps in avoiding overconsumption and emotional eating.
Adolescents and Teens:
  • Balanced Nutritional Intake: Focus on a balanced diet that meets the unique nutritional requirements of growing bodies. Incorporate whole foods and limit processed items.
  • Active Habits: Promote participation in team sports, dance, or any physical activity they enjoy. This not only aids in weight management but also enhances self-esteem and social interactions.

Weight Maintenance

Working Professionals:
  • Meal Planning: Encourage meal prepping and planning to avoid unhealthy impulse eating during busy workdays.
  • Nutrient-Packed Meals: Prioritize meals rich in vitamins, minerals, and lean proteins to sustain energy levels and mental clarity.
  • Active Desk Breaks: Suggest incorporating brief stretches or walking breaks to counteract the passive nature of desk jobs.
  • Stress Management: Advocate stress-reduction techniques like deep breathing or short meditation breaks to prevent stress-related overeating.
Older Adults:
  • Protein and Nutrient Intake: Highlight the importance of maintaining protein intake for muscle preservation and bone health.
  • Nutrient-Rich Choices: Emphasize foods rich in ant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als that support immune function and overall vitality.
  • Appropriate Physical Activity: Encourage age-appropriate activities like gentle yoga, swimming, or resistance training to promote flexibility, balance, and muscle health.

Weight Gain

Athletes and Fitness Enthusiasts:
  • Caloric Surplus: Strategically increase caloric intake while focusing on nutrient-dense sources to fuel workouts and support muscle growth.
  • Macronutrient Balance: Prioritize a balanced intake of carbohydrates, proteins and healthy fats to optimize energy levels and recovery.
  • Strength Training: Advocate for consistent strength training routines to capitalize on the increased calorie intake for muscle development.
Underweight Individuals:
  • Gradual Calorie Increase: Plan gradual increases in caloric intake to allow the body to adapt without overwhelming the digestive system.
  • Calorie-Dense Foods: Include calorie-dense options like nuts, seeds, avocados, and whole-fat dairy to promote healthy weight gain.
  • Balanced Nutritional Profile: Encourage nutrient-rich choices to ensure that weight gain is accompanied by overall health improvement.

Pregnant or Breastfeeding Women:

  • Balanced Nutrition: Focus on a balanced diet that meets increased nutritional needs during pregnancy and lactation.
  • Appropriate Caloric Increase: Gradually increase caloric intake to support maternal health and fetal development.
  • Hydration and Nutrient Intake: Emphasize hydration and sources of essential nutrients like calcium, iron, and folic acid to support both mother and baby.
